CII IF1 Exam Syllabus Topics:
| Section | Weight | Objectives |
|---|---|---|
| Topic 1: Risk and Insurance | 10% | - Risk management and control methods - Features of insurable risk - Concepts of risk and types of risk |
| Topic 2: Principle of Insurable Interest | 5% | - When insurable interest must exist - Application in different insurance types - Definition and legal basis |
| Topic 3: Nature and Structure of Insurance | 14% | - Market structures and distribution channels - Classification of insurance business - Participants in the insurance market - Purpose and benefits of insurance |
| Topic 4: Principle of Utmost Good Faith | 11% | - Remedies for breach of duty - Insurance Act 2015 provisions - Duty of disclosure and representation |
| Topic 5: Compulsory Insurance and Legislation | 3% | - Statutory requirements for compulsory insurance - Key relevant statutes |
| Topic 6: Proximate Cause | 2% | - Application to claims settlement - Definition and identification |
| Topic 7: Contribution and Subrogation | 6% | - Right of contribution between insurers - Right of subrogation and its limits |
| Topic 8: Ethics and Professional Standards | 3% | - CII Code of Ethics - Application to insurance scenarios |
| Topic 9: Principle of Indemnity | 7% | - Exceptions to indemnity - Meaning and purpose of indemnity - Average clause application - Methods of providing indemnity |
| Topic 10: Consumer Protection and Dispute Resolution | 8% | - Financial Services Compensation Scheme (FSCS) - Complaints handling procedures - Financial Ombudsman Service (FOS) - Consumer Insurance (Disclosure and Representations) Act 2012 |
| Topic 11: UK Regulatory Framework | 12% | - Insurance Distribution Directive (IDD) - Authorisation and supervision - ICOBS rules and conduct standards - Role of PRA and FCA |
| Topic 12: Contract and Agency Law | 9% | - Essentials of a valid contract - Application to insurance contracts - Law of agency and authority |
